Hi Renata — handing over hardware lab duties at Quellin Labs while I'm off next week. The lab door on level 4 sticks a bit, so push while you badge in. Danil from the prototyping team has a standing booking Tuesdays; everyone else needs a slot in the shared calendar. Please restock the antistatic wristbands if we're low — supplies cupboard is inside on the left. The keypad by the door takes the code below.

door code, yagap-bahof: bdg-O-05

Management Meeting Minutes — Attendees: R. Calloway, D. Venn, P. Ostrik. Agenda: transition from Harliss Freight to Quandel Logistics. Venn confirmed contract termination terms with Harliss carry no penalty after the notice period. Ostrik presented cost comparisons showing a 7% projected saving. Finance to model cash-flow impact by month-end. The following note outlines the confidential plan guiding this change.

board note of kagep-yahig: Only 9 of the 120 pilot accounts renewed Quenix, so a churn review is set for April 1.

Handover Note — Corporate Development

For the board, from Theo Maddavane to incoming director Ilsa Prenn.

Quick summary before I step back: we've been circling Tarnwell Instruments for about four months. Their sensor line fills our biggest product gap, and their founder seems open to a deal. Diligence materials are in the secure folder; valuation work is roughly 70% done. Ilsa takes the file from here. Key terms under discussion appear in the confidential note below.

internal memo for yawif-yajop: The board signed off on a budget of $8.7 million for Project Normir. The renewal with Ulaethek Foods closes at $35.2 million a year, 31 percent above the last contract.

// Timezone handling for Ledgerleaf report exports.
// All timestamps are stored in UTC; this constant defines the
// fallback offset used when a workspace has no configured zone.
// Do not localize dates earlier in the pipeline — the Driftport
// rendering layer applies the zone exactly once at export time,
// and double conversion caused the skewed quarterly reports last
// spring. If you change this value, regenerate the export fixtures.
// The fixture set was generated against the build noted below.

pipeline stamp: htk31_f769b577b3028a4e9958e5bb8d1259a